Macy’s Thanksgiving Day Parade Date and Broadcast

The Macy’s Thanksgiving Day Parade traditionally takes place on Thanksgiving morning in New York City, with the 2024 edition scheduled for the fourth Thursday of November. The parade begins at 9:00 a.m. Eastern Time and airs live on NBC and Peacock, with a tape-delayed broadcast for the West Coast. Parade Participants, Balloons, and Corporate Involvement

The 2024 parade includes over 50 giant balloons and novelty balloons, with new character introductions and legacy favorites such as Snoopy, SpongeBob SquarePants, and the Pillsbury Doughboy. Corporate floats are sponsored by major brands, with each balloon and float requiring months of design, engineering, and testing to meet safety and FAA flight regulations Forbes Parade Business Coverage.

Balloon Inflation and Safety Protocols

Balloon inflation begins the evening before Thanksgiving at the American Museum of Natural History, with weather-dependent timing and strict wind-speed limits enforced by the New York City Police Department. Each balloon requires a team of handlers, and the process is open to the public with free viewing along Columbus Avenue and Central Park West NYC Official Parade Information.
